public final class TextColumnFactory extends AbstractTableColumnFactory
TextColumn.COLUMN_ELEMENT_DEFAULT_VALUE_ATTRIBUTE| Constructor and Description |
|---|
TextColumnFactory()
Cria a fábrica.
|
| Modifier and Type | Method and Description |
|---|---|
protected TextColumn |
createColumn(XmlParser parser,
java.lang.String parameterName,
java.lang.String label,
java.lang.String id,
boolean isOptional,
boolean isEditable,
SimpleAlgorithmConfigurator configurator)
Cria a coluna.
|
void |
setCellValue(XmlParser parser,
java.lang.String parameterName,
TableColumn<?> column,
int rowIndex,
java.lang.String valueAttributeName)
Atribui o valor a uma célula na coluna.
|
createColumn, getElementNamepublic void setCellValue(XmlParser parser, java.lang.String parameterName, TableColumn<?> column, int rowIndex, java.lang.String valueAttributeName)
setCellValue in interface TableColumnFactorysetCellValue in class AbstractTableColumnFactoryparser - O analisador de XML (Não aceita null).parameterName - O nome da tabela que está sendo processado (Não aceita
null).column - A coluna que será alterada (Não aceita null).rowIndex - O índice da linha.valueAttributeName - O nome do atributo de XML com o valor-padrão da
célula (Não aceita null).protected TextColumn createColumn(XmlParser parser, java.lang.String parameterName, java.lang.String label, java.lang.String id, boolean isOptional, boolean isEditable, SimpleAlgorithmConfigurator configurator) throws ParseException
createColumn in class AbstractTableColumnFactoryparser - O analisador de XML (Não aceita null).parameterName - O nome da tabela que está sendo processado (Não aceita
null).label - O rótulo da coluna.id - O identificador da coluna.isOptional - Flag que indica se a coluna é opcional true ou
obrigatório false.isEditable - Flag que indica se a coluna é editável true ou
não false.configurator - O configurador de algoritmos (Não aceita null).ParseException - Se houver um erro no XML.Copyright © 2016. All Rights Reserved.